What does the 23% vitamin C suspension with HA spheres mean, and how should I choose it versus a 30% silicone-based formula?
The key difference lies in delivery and hydration: 23% vitamin C with HA spheres provides gentler, hydrated delivery due to the hyaluronic acid, while 30% silicone-based suspensions offer a stronger brightening effect but may feel heavier and be prickly for sensitive skin. HA spheres release moisture as you apply, helping cushion irritation and improving texture over time. Choose based on tolerance and needs: opt for the HA-containing 23% formula if you’re new or have dry skin; go for the 30% silicone option if you want more noticeable results and your skin handles higher strength.

How should I maintain and apply vitamin C suspension to keep it effective and safe?
Apply vitamin C suspension to clean, dry skin and patch test before full use to check for irritation. Use it once daily or every other day, depending on tolerance, and layer moisturizers after the serum. Do not mix with strong actives in the same routine (such as retinoids overnight or benzoyl peroxide), and finish with sunscreen in the morning. Store the bottle away from light and heat, keeping the cap tight to preserve stability.
What common mistakes should I avoid with vitamin C suspension, and how can I correct them?
Avoid applying vitamin C suspension on damp or recently exfoliated skin, which can increase irritation. Don’t start with high concentrations immediately; ease in gradually. Don’t mix multiple vitamin C products or incompatible actives in the same routine, and don’t skip sunscreen after daytime use.
